Skyview 7PCS Power Function Motor Set

The Skyview 7PCS Power Function Motor Set, emerging as a dependable Chinese alternative to Lego® Technic, delivers a specialized package for dedicated block builders.

The set encompasses:

  • 2 x Medium Motors
  • 1 x Receiver
  • 1 x Power Function Switch
  • 1 x LED Cable
  • 1 x Remote (batteries not included)
  • 1 x Battery Box (batteries not included)

Engineered for efficiency, the system can simultaneously power 2 XL-motors or 4 M-motors, supporting both forward and reverse operations. Notably, its compatibility extends beyond Lego, accommodating other major brands like Lego, Mega Bloks®, and K'Nex®. This interoperability enables users to integrate dynamic movement into their bespoke creations across various platforms. Lego® Motor Alternatives: Why are they interesting?

Lego® motor alternatives are increasingly catching the attention of both young and adult Lego fans for a variety of reasons. From being customizable to being able to move objects in a more precise way, these motor alternatives are comparable to Lego motor models. Here are some reasons why they are interesting.

Offer better specs

Lego® Motor Alternatives may offer better specs as these motors provide a much higher torque-to-weight ratio than their Lego equivalents such as WANGCL for Lego M Motor 8883. It has a speed that goes up to 700 rpm, and torque up to 20 Ncm. This means that it can produce more power while consuming less energy and still maintaining its durability. Additionally, it is also much quieter than a standard Lego motor.

Easier to control

Lego® motor alternatives are becoming increasingly popular with MOC builders and hobbyists, as they offer a great way to control a model's movement. With a Lego motor alternative like RUIZHI Servo Motor, you can control the speed of your model with precision, allowing you to create complex movements that would be impossible with traditional motors.

You can also adjust the power output of the motor so that it is suitable for the size of your model. This means that you don't have to worry about overpowering smaller models or underpowering larger ones.

More versatility

Lego Motors® are specifically designed for Lego models, making them the ideal choice when you need a motor that specifically fits the model you need. However, if you're looking for a motor that can be used for a wide range of projects, then a Lego Motor alternative might be the better choice.

For example RUIZHI, it is extremely versatile as it can be used with a variety of different brick systems such as when you are building Lego Technic alternatives. This means that you can use the same motor for multiple different projects, without having to source separate parts or motors for each one.

Lego® Motor Alternatives: Checklist

When it comes to sourcing Lego® motor alternatives to switch up your Lego collection, there are a few things that you should keep in mind before deciding which to buy. Here is a handy checklist that can help you make sure you’re getting the best products that will fit best to your needs:

Power

The power requirements for your project will also influence your choice of motor. If you need a powerful motor, there are many Lego® Motor alternatives that excel in this area even outshining Lego. One of the ideal candidates for this is the TOIL Technology Motors.

Efficiency & Speed

When selecting your motor, it’s important to consider how fast and efficiently it will work to get the desired results especially if you are building sets like Lego cars. Compare specs such as RPM (rotations per minute) and torque ratings before making your selection.

Size

Know the size of the motor that you will need for the type of project you're working on. If you need a small motor, you may be able to find one that's compatible with Lego® bricks. Fortunately, there are some motor alternatives that offer a smaller and more compact design in comparison to Lego which usually is on the bulkier side.

Price

Check on the prices of several alternatives and narrow them down based on your budget. With Lego® motor alternatives, they are often inexpensive compared to the Lego models and they offer the same (sometimes higher) level of quality and performance. But it's not always the case. Sometimes buying cheaper alternatives would risk the quality of the product.

Compatibility & Connectivity Options

Make sure you check if the motor is compatible with existing components in your build and that there are plenty of connectivity options available for easy integration into other systems such as remote control systems or computer systems for automated control or data logging purposes respectively.
